M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


3 participantes

    [Resolvido]Botão Obter dados de Subform

    gumz
    gumz
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 103
    Registrado : 30/07/2011

    [Resolvido]Botão Obter dados de Subform Empty Botão Obter dados de Subform

    Mensagem  gumz 16/8/2011, 20:58

    Boa tarde, amigos

    Estou tentando fazer um botão que puxe os dados de um subform para o form principal, mas não estou conseguindo.

    Estou tentando isto ao clicar:

    Me!ENDERECO = Forms!form_index!indu_subformulario1.END_FAB

    mas obtenho:

    Erro de execução 2465
    Não é possível encontrar o campo "indu_subformulario1" -


    só que "indu_subformulario1" é o nome do subform, não campo...

    Form_index é o nome do form principal.

    Alguém poderia me dizer onde estou errando?
    criquio
    criquio
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 11229
    Registrado : 30/12/2009

    [Resolvido]Botão Obter dados de Subform Empty Re: [Resolvido]Botão Obter dados de Subform

    Mensagem  criquio 16/8/2011, 21:08

    Aonde está o botão que você clica? No form ou no subform? Talvez fosse melhor colocar o botão no subform. E ao clicar no botão, em uma linha, levar os dados dessa linha para o form principal:

    Forms!NomeFormPrincipal!NomeCampo = Me.NomeCampoDoSubForm


    .................................................................................
    Meu novo site: www.vcssistemas.com.br

    Clique aqui e veja um vídeo que explica como fazer pesquisas no forum.


    DICA: Quando precisar inserir um exemplo do seu aplicativo, siga os procedimentos abaixo:
    1 - faça uma cópia do aplicativo
    2 - retire tudo que não for necessário à solução do problema, exceto o que o aplicativo precisar para funcionar
    3 - use o Compactar/Reparar
    4 - compacte o aplicativo em zip ou rar (zip para postagem como anexo na mensagem)


    Agradeça a quem lhe ajudou, clicando no joinha de uma das mensagens do usuário.
    Positive as mensagens que achar útil, no canto superior direito delas.

    gumz
    gumz
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 103
    Registrado : 30/07/2011

    [Resolvido]Botão Obter dados de Subform Empty Re: [Resolvido]Botão Obter dados de Subform

    Mensagem  gumz 16/8/2011, 21:18

    Olá, criquio

    Obrigado pela resposta.

    Este botão que estou tentando fazer fica no form principal.

    Já tenho um outro, que estou usando ao contrário, com o botão puxando para dentro do subform desta maneira e funciona bem:


    Me!END_FAB = Forms!form_index!ENDERECO


    Desta maneira que você me passou funciona bem, mas aí não se vê a inclusão na hora, já que ele está numa aba - o que poderia confundir algumas das pessoas que utilizam este form, penso eu.

    Não existiria uma maneira de fazer desta forma? De todo jeito, assim, de dentro do subform, fica bom. Se não der, vai assim mesmo até outra solução, rs.

    vieirasoft
    vieirasoft
    Developer
    Developer


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7304
    Registrado : 11/05/2010

    [Resolvido]Botão Obter dados de Subform Empty Re: [Resolvido]Botão Obter dados de Subform

    Mensagem  vieirasoft 18/8/2011, 11:04

    Estou a puxar o tópico para cima. se já tiver resolvido, agradeço o seu retorno.
    gumz
    gumz
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 103
    Registrado : 30/07/2011

    [Resolvido]Botão Obter dados de Subform Empty Re: [Resolvido]Botão Obter dados de Subform

    Mensagem  gumz 18/8/2011, 13:30

    Olá, Vieira -

    Fiz um botão como o criquio me sugeriu - mas como eu disse, não é possível visualizar as alterações no mesmo instante, mesmo porque o campo a ser substituído não está completamente vazio - o que pode gerar erro de dados por aqui - então, não o resolvi ainda.

    Da forma que postei, obtenho erro direto - apesar de ter testado de várias formas.

    Alguém sabe se isto é possível de ser feito, por favor? Um botão dentro do subform que envia dados dele para o form principal?

    Agradeço quaisquer sugestões!
    vieirasoft
    vieirasoft
    Developer
    Developer


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7304
    Registrado : 11/05/2010

    [Resolvido]Botão Obter dados de Subform Empty Re: [Resolvido]Botão Obter dados de Subform

    Mensagem  vieirasoft 18/8/2011, 13:35

    Não conheço a BD, nem a estrutura. É possível que necessite disso, eu nunca na minha vida precisei de enviar dados de um subform para um principal e na minha modesta opinião, tenho a certeza que tal não seria necessário. Normalmente a relação de um para muitos é suficiente. Mas existem sempre excepções.
    gumz
    gumz
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 103
    Registrado : 30/07/2011

    [Resolvido]Botão Obter dados de Subform Empty Re: [Resolvido]Botão Obter dados de Subform

    Mensagem  gumz 18/8/2011, 13:53

    Grato pela resposta, Vieira!

    Realmente, se fosse uma base única, com dados do zero, não haveria necessidade disto.

    Mas o que acontece é o seguinte:

    Estou fazendo um base de dados nova, configurando cada ponto que necessito.

    Só que ao mesmo tempo existe uma base já existente, que utiliza tabelas mdb do Access 97, porém com um executável fechado - que não sei em que linguagem foi desenvolvida -- que possui outras funções, não só de armazenamento de dados, mas geração de outros arquivos, envio de dados para internet, etc - o que inviabiliza, no momento, eu refazer todas estas funções. E na nova base posso agregar funções que não são possíveis de se adicionar à antiga...

    Então tenho uma consulta que compara os números de meus cadastros - que são os mesmos da base mais antiga, e me mostra as informações já incluídas em outra aba. Como já existem muitas entradas nesta base antiga e outras tantas na nova, e as informações nunca são digitadas duma vez só, ora numa base, ora noutra, e onde não houver informações de uma ou outra eu tenho um botão que intercambia as informações dos campos.

    Logicamente, e futuramente, com certeza, toda informação será digitada nesta base nova - daí o botão perderá o uso - mas enquanto tenho dados entre uma e outra e não tenho poucos registros (algo entre 1000 registros), gostaria de fazer algo do tipo - o botão que puxe subform para o form.

    Mas não sendo possível, este que possuo já me serve - tendo eu então dois botões dentro do subform.
    vieirasoft
    vieirasoft
    Developer
    Developer


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7304
    Registrado : 11/05/2010

    [Resolvido]Botão Obter dados de Subform Empty Re: [Resolvido]Botão Obter dados de Subform

    Mensagem  vieirasoft 18/8/2011, 13:58

    Eu entendo, está com um pepino em mãos, mas o facto é que o Criquio deu-lhe a dica certa acima. Seria a mesma que eu lhe daria para passar um dado de um sub para um principal.
    vieirasoft
    vieirasoft
    Developer
    Developer


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7304
    Registrado : 11/05/2010

    [Resolvido]Botão Obter dados de Subform Empty Re: [Resolvido]Botão Obter dados de Subform

    Mensagem  vieirasoft 18/8/2011, 14:02

    Tente passar o focus para o campo

    Forms!NomeFormPrincipal!NomeCampo.setfocus

    Forms!NomeFormPrincipal!NomeCampo = Me.NomeCampoDoSubForm

    Experimente, por favor
    gumz
    gumz
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 103
    Registrado : 30/07/2011

    [Resolvido]Botão Obter dados de Subform Empty Re: [Resolvido]Botão Obter dados de Subform

    Mensagem  gumz 18/8/2011, 14:35

    Vieira

    Obtenho um erro - "Objeto não encontrado" - algo do tipo.

    Mas vou fazer desta forma mesmo - manterei o botão dentro do subform.

    O que eu temia é disponibilizar tal botão para vários usuários e ter sobreposição de dados - mas já decidi que não o manterei - somente eu farei uso do mesmo, mantendo a integridade das informções.

    Todavia, o código que o criquio me passou funciona muito bem.

    O que impede de eu ver as alterações é o fato de eu ter este segundo formulário numa aba. Se eu arrumar a tela para que fique visível, este campo abaixo ou ao lado, ou um formulário que abra e feche somente quando eu solicitar, mantendo os forms lado a lado, ou abaixo, terei uma solução para o caso de eu poder ver as alterações no mesmo instante - é isso que farei.

    É verdade que esta situação que tenho é meio incomum, mas nada que impeça o fluxo do trabalho.

    Agradeço o auxílio e dou este tópico como resolvido!

    Saudações!


    Conteúdo patrocinado


    [Resolvido]Botão Obter dados de Subform Empty Re: [Resolvido]Botão Obter dados de Subform

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 8/11/2024, 05:41